Borussia Dortmund increases the pressure on Nico Schlotterbeck after the victory in Wolfsburg. BVB demands clarity about his future from the defense chief soon.

After the important 2-1 away win at VfL Wolfsburg, a topic at Borussia Dortmund is coming even more into focus than the victory itself: the future of Nico Schlotterbeck. Sporting director Sebastian Kehl made it publicly clear after the match that the club does not want to wait any longer and expects a timely decision from the defense chief.

“We are on the gas pedal,” Kehl stated unequivocally to Bild and added: “Nico knows that we want a decision as soon as possible!” A clear message to the 26-year-old, whose contract with BVB runs until 2027, but whose future has long become a central topic of conversation. Schlotterbeck had recently taken the lead not only in sports but also verbally.

With openly expressed title ambitions, the central defender attracted attention and emphasized his stance after the Wolfsburg game: “I am passionate about it.” Schlotterbeck's importance is repeatedly highlighted at the management level as well. Sporting director Lars Ricken praised his mentality and demeanor to the WAZ: “We like players who are ambitious and confident and stand up for themselves and their colleagues. We love that about him.”

Ricken ennobles Schlotterbeck with comparisons to BVB icons

To underscore this importance, Ricken even drew comparisons with former club icons like Jürgen Kohler or Mats Hummels – players who shaped the club's face for years. Behind the scenes, discussions are already in full swing. Dortmund is eager to keep Schlotterbeck and is said to have presented him with a long-term offer at the financial pain threshold.

According to Bild information, around 14 million euros per season are on the table, and in the event of an extension, even a possible release clause. At the same time, the officials know: If the national player hesitates too long, a sale might become necessary in the summer to still achieve a high transfer fee.

Schlotterbeck himself recently emphasized that he wants to take his time with his decision. “I have set a personal deadline for myself. But I won't say exactly when that is,” he said a few weeks ago. It is now clear: BVB is increasing the pressure and wants clarity – as soon as possible. Whether a decision will be made before the league summit against FC Bayern at the end of February remains open. However, the signs point to movement.
